Which banknotes have the largest share in circulation?

According to the Central Bank of the Republic of Uzbekistan, as of January 1, 2026, the largest share in the structure of cash in circulation was accounted for by the 100,000 soum banknote - 36.4%.
In second place was the 200,000 sum banknote, the share of which was 28.5%. These figures show that large denominations are becoming increasingly dominant in cash circulation.
At the same time, the Central Bank notes that the share of use of small banknotes among the population is decreasing. That is, the saying "it's difficult to make small money" is not just a complaint - it's becoming a trend.
